网站优化

网站优化

Products

当前位置:首页 > 网站优化 >

如何详细解释Hive中创建数据库的命令操作步骤?

GG网络技术分享 2025-10-26 01:23 1


CREATE DATABASE IF NOT EXISTS test_db COMMENT 'This is a test database.' LOCATION 'hdfs://localhost:/user/hive/test_db' WITH DBPROPERTIES ;

Hive, 作为基于Hadoop的数据仓库工具,为巨大规模数据给了高大效处理能力。本文将详细介绍在Hive中创建数据库的命令操作步骤。

基础命令解析

在Hive SQL中, 创建数据库的基础命令为CREATE DATABASE,若数据库已存在则命令会输了。为了避免这种情况,能在命令中加入IF NOT EXISTS条件。

关键步骤详解

施行上述命令后 Hive会在指定位置创建名为test_db的数据库,并添加注释和配置属性。需要留意的是Hive会自动为数据库许多些两个表属性:last_modified_by和last_modified_time。

实践示例

虚假设我们需要创建一个名为mydb的数据库,该数据库存储在HDFS上的默认路径为/opt/hive/warehouse/mydb.db。

CREATE DATABASE IF NOT EXISTS mydb LOCATION 'hdfs://localhost:/user/hive/warehouse/mydb.db';

注意事项

在创建数据库时 需要确保数据库名称不包含空格,且数据库在HDFS上的存储路径是正规的。

本文详细介绍了在Hive中创建数据库的命令操作步骤, 包括基础命令解析、关键步骤详解和实践示例。希望对巨大家在实际操作中有所帮。

欢迎用实际体验验证观点。

标签:

提交需求或反馈

Demand feedback